I've tried the Rust Check branded version of this but didn't have much success... however, that might more be related to the fact that I only used it on really stubborn stuff where Liquid Wrench on it's own wouldn't do it (that's what I normally use and wait overnight for it to penetrate). I'm in the rustbelt so everything needs this stuff. I will say, that the items that the freeze off stuff wouldn't loosen also did not come apart with heat (though I didn't get the parts glowing red). It is probably easier to achieve a higher temperature differential with a torch, and that is what is needed to get parts to crack through thermal expansion deltas...
Usually my best bet has been to go to a bigger breaker bar (I've got a 4' long 1" thick 3/4" drive one).
